As of March 30th, Adobe made Generative Turntable a reality in the standalone app. If you haven't seen it yet, it basically allows you to take flat, 2D vector artwork and spin it like a 3D object to see different angles and top-down views. 



A couple of people had commented on the YouTube video, and for their fashion careers, this cuts the costs and time to render a vector drawing in seconds versus hours. The speed is undeniable.
